Wendell,
 
I can't prove it so I'll let someone else vouch for this but my=20 recollection is that the thread is 1/8" BSPT. 
 
It's been a few years since I bought one but I think this is what = you=20 want:
 
htt= p://www.autometer.com/cat_accessoriesdetail.aspx?vid=3D59
 
Product 2269 adapts an SAE 1/8" NPT thread to this 1/8" BSPT thread = that's=20 listed under their metric adapters. Worked for me.
 
There are probably other vendors besides Autometer but I bought = from them,=20 IIRC.
